CIR Panel To Consider Re-Reviewing AHA Safety As Use Rises

With use of alpha hydroxy acids in personal-care products on the upswing, the Cosmetic Ingredient Review Expert Panel will revisit the ingredient group’s safety report and consider re-opening a review at its next meeting.

At its Dec. 9-10 meeting in Washington, the Cosmetic Ingredient Review Expert Panel will decide whether to take another in-depth look at the safety of alpha hydroxy acids in light of increased use and concentration levels in personal-care products on the market.
